There are two main types of solar power. One produces electricity, the other produces heat.
The electrical type are called “photovoltaics”, the heat type are “thermal”.
Photovoltaics are not presently very efficient, converting less than 15% of the suns energy to electricity, but by the time you build, they should be surpass, and cheaper. Thermal solar is much more efficient, especially if you use it to heat your water, because the system runs all year. Home heating is not as excellent, because winter is not a excellent time to collect solar. When you design your house, you can take advantage of “passive” solar, which is basically putting a lot of excellent windows on the south side (or north side if you are south of the equator!) and letting the winter sun shine in. These windows need to be very excellent, or have an insulator to cover them at night and cloudy days or they will gain energy all day, only to lose all of it at night.
As far as your house goes, it’s not so much a matter of how huge it is, as how well insulated it is. If you “super protect” it, you will need very very small heating or cooling energy.
The other cost you will have is for things like computers, refrigerators, TVs, sound systems, lights, fans, cooking gear and water heating. By alternative the most efficient, you can reduce the size of the photovoltaic system you would need, and using solar water heating will handle 50% of the yearly amount with present technology for about $3500. A photovoltaic system to handle all your electrical needs would be quite expensive now, in the $10,000 to $20,000 range, but that cost will continue to fall, and by the time you build it should be closer to $5000.

A quick down and dirty way to get some numbers is to get your last 12 electric bills. total the kWh and divide it by 12. Divide that by 30. Divide that by the peak sun hours a day. For the USA could be anywhere from 3 hours a day to 5 hours a day. That will be some where near the size of a system you will need in kWh. Mutiply that by about 8 dollars.
So if you have 575 kWh usage per month divided by 30 days gives you 19 kWh per day. Divide by 4 sun hours per day. You will need a 4.79 kWh system. So now 4,790 watts times 8 dollars a watt is $38,320 USD.
That is an thought of how to find the rough numbers. Now if you do all the work your self you could save a dollar or even two by not paying someone to do it for you.

#1 it won`t work if you don`t have SUN. If you`re in a region where you have varying amounts of cloud cover your effectiveness may be deminished. Also consider exsisting trees. They will also factor into the equation. SNOW. A blanket of this stuff all through the night will shut you down come morning. An upside question you may want to question, will your power company buy your surplus if unfilled?
